Contract Notice and procurement strategy

On 2 April 2013, the Audit Commission announced that it would retender audit contracts awarded in 2006 and 2007 representing approximately 30 per cent of the local public audit market.

The Commission has today published a Contract Notice in the Official Journal of the European Union. The Contract Notice can also be found on the Contracts Finder website

The Commission has also published its Procurement strategy 2013 which sets out the objectives of the procurement and how it will be carried out.

The timetable below sets out the dates currently planned for the key stages of the procurement. This is intended as a guide and while the Commission does not intend to depart from the timetable, it reserves the right to do so at any stage. 

Key stage Target date
Publication of Contract Notice in the Official Journal of the European Union and pre-qualification questionnaire (PQQ) available on request 3 October 2013
Deadline for return of PQQs 8 November 2013
Issue invitations to tender to selected suppliers 9 December 2013
Deadline for submission of tenders 24 January 2014
Approval of contract awards 25 March 2014
Confirmation of auditor appointments By 31 December 2014
Commencement of services 1 April 2015
